  19. Digger54

    Crystal River Friday

    Be very careful to observe the rules about areas which require "idle speed" or "no wake" operation and avoid areas that are designated as sanctuaries for the manatees. I understand they take such rules very seriously there and there can be some pretty stiff penalties.
  20. Digger54

    suit/components for Florida Springs in Dec

    I just returned from FL spring country. As Netsloth said, water temps will be the same in December as in the rest of the year. 69-72 or so degrees. I tend to get a little chilled diving so I wore a 3mm fullsuit over a 5/3 hooded vest, 3mm gloves and my usual 5mm booties. I was with divers...
